wvr 05-07-2004 03:49 AM

RE: Building a JR models Diablo
 
Hi,

I agree, a 91FX is not enough for the Diablo-2000, use a 160FX and you will have a great plane.

Use good quality servo's for the elevators, they are large, and even the smalles centering problem will cause the plane to search a bit on the horizontal axis.

I flew the Diablo in both a pattern and 3D setup.

For pattern style with a 17x12APC, and reduced throws by moving the ball-links on the servo arm.
For 3D a 19x8W APC and large throws.

It's a fun and nice plane to fly.
